Transaction 54e905c25957048e5c27b9e95db04d5f7d9c947e257c939ca16282f0cd2d849f

60 Input
1 Outputs
  • 54e905c25957048e5c27b9e95db04d5f7d9c947e257c939ca16282f0cd2d849f:0
  • value  17645373662
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h